Superb UK Travel Guide: Best Destinations to Uncover
The United Kingdom is a land of captivating history, stunning landscapes, and vibrant towns. Whether you're a history buff, a nature lover, or a food enthusiast, there's something for everyone in this wonderful nation.
From the bustling streets of London to the rugged beauty of Scotland, your UK a